This January will be more intense than usual because Suzy is doing a big-deal Industry Reading for Chick Flick the Musical. It will be in NYC at Ripley-Grier Studios (520 8th Avenue) on Thursday, January 14th at 3pm; and Friday, January 15th at 11am.

It’s directed by Mary Catherine Burke and choreographed by Tiffany Green, and features Danette Holden (Shrek the MusicalAnnie); Jennifer C Johnson (Volleygirls the Musical); Alli Mauzey (WickedHairspray; Cry Baby); and Megan Sikora (Curtains; Promises, Promises; How to Succeed in Business Without Really Trying). It’s 90 minutes, no intermission and it’s done as a standard Equity 29-hour reading. Producers are David Carpenter and John Pinckard of Tilted Windmills Theatricals, and the Music Director is Suzy’s long-time collaborator Seth Weinstein. Vocal arrangements and orchestrations are being done by Frank Galgano & Matt Castle and they’ve been a great new addition to the team!
